描述Resin Transfer Moulding and other similar ‘liquid moulding‘manufacturing methods have been used to make non-structural compositesfor the last 35 years. However, in the last eight years these methodshave become the subject of enormous interest by aerospacemanufacturing companies. ..Resin Transfer Moulding for Aerospace Structures. describes allaspects of Resin Transfer Moulding (RTM) for aerospace structures.Written by an international team of experts, from both industry andacademia, it is a comprehensive work providing complete and detailedinformation on the process of RTM from theoretical modelling topractical experience. With subjects including manufacturing, tooling,fabric design and flow modelling all covered, this book is aninvaluable up-to-the-minute reference source which provides the readerwith a good understanding of RTM and its possible uses, especially forhigh performance applications. ..Resin Transfer Moulding for Aerospace Structures. is an idealguide for those in the aerospace and related industries, who want tounderstand and utilize RTM, as well as those directly involved in theRTM industry.

Manufacturing and tooling cost factors,The need to reduce the cost of composite parts is critical in these economic times. The traditional manufacturing method of prepreg lay-up is labour intensive and requires autoclave curing. Reducing product cost while maintaining quality is imperative. Resin transfer moulding (RTM) is one method that can reduce the cost of composites.
